However, hook defined like that could pose a security threat to your system, because anyone who knows your endpoint, can send a request and execute your command. To prevent that, you can use the `"trigger-rule"` property for your hook, to specify the exact circumstances under which the hook would be triggered. For example, you can use them to add a secret that you must supply as a parameter in order to successfully trigger the hook. Please check out the [Hook rules page](https://github.com/adnanh/webhook/wiki/Hook-Rules) for detailed list of available rules and their usage.

# Using HTTPS
|
||||
[webhook](https://github.com/adnanh/webhook/) by default serves hooks using http. If you want [webhook](https://github.com/adnanh/webhook/) to serve secure content using https, you can use the `-secure` flag while starting [webhook](https://github.com/adnanh/webhook/). Files containing a certificate and matching private key for the server must be provided using the `-cert /path/to/cert.pem` and `-key /path/to/key.pem` flags. If the certificate is signed by a certificate authority, the cert file should be the concatenation of the server's certificate followed by the CA's certificate.
